Synthesis report on school timetables

The steering committee of the national conference on school time comes to make its interim report, summary of hearings, debates and exchanges.

week 4 days is unanimous when its drawbacks " fatigue of students and teaching crunch"; " it is neither good for the health of children, or effective point Educationally .
The report launches a series of discussion questions; " at this stage, should encourage the development of [the] formula [Current which leaves the possibility for schools to stay four days or spend four and a half days] or impose a national procedure? Should we advocate one model over another: Wednesday or Saturday? .

The duration of the lunch break is also an issue; considered essentially too short, it is a stress factor for students, especially when using custom is added to it.

Then ' the summer holidays are debate "" decreased [presumably the first week of July and last August] would be considered if it resulted in a better alternation of working time and vacation time . The committee wants the alternating 7 weeks of school / 2 weeks off to be more respected.

Another question the committee: "Can we change schools without changing rhythms teaching content ? , a student of 3 years and one high school they should have the same holiday calendar?

Finally, the committee, this can be done without a change in the teaching profession in particular the redefinition of its missions . " The possibility of an evolution, in any case could not be done without compensation. "

The editors, however, remain cautious," before arriving at specific proposals, [he] wants to enrich his reflections on the European-inspired "and" deepen still insufficiently explored fields such as culture and Digital .
